A New Commissioner for the U.S. Virgin Islands Department of Tourism

Jennifer Matarangas-King has officially been sworn in as Commissioner of the U.S. Virgin Islands Department of Tourism, during a ceremony at Government House on St. Croix. Confirmed Leadership Matarangas-King was confirmed by the 36th Legislature of the United States Virgin Islands in November 2025, following her appointment by Governor Bryan in August of the same […]

At Andre Fowles’ Jamaican Table, Food Carries Memory, History, and Heat

Jamaica’s cultural diversity runs deep. Taíno, African, Indian, Spanish, Chinese, German, Portuguese, Syrian, Lebanese, English, Irish, French, and Welsh roots have all shaped the island’s art, music, folklore, language, and cuisine. Food sits at the center of that cultural expression, reflecting centuries of resilience, adaptation, and celebration. From fiery spices to aromatic herbs, Jamaican cooking […]
